Description: Northwoods Child Development Center is a Licensed Group Child Care in Eagle River WI, with a maximum capacity of 57 children. This child care center helps with children in the age range of 6 Week(s) - 13 Year(s). The provider does not participate in a subsidized child care program.

Violation Date | Rule Number | Rule Summary |
---|---|---|
2021-08-31 | Licensing | No violations found *** |
2021-06-22 | 251.05(3)(c) |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ation Training |
Description: Staff A does not have a current certification in infant and child CPR with training in the use of an AED. | ||
2021-06-22 | 251.05(3)(f)3. | Child Care Teacher - Entry-Level Training |
Description: Staff B, who has been assigned as the teacher in the 2 year old classroom for approximately one month, does not meet the educational qualifications. | ||
2021-06-22 | 251.055(1)(f) | Child Tracking Procedure |
Description: The Center's tracking procedure was not followed when teachers in the 3 year old classroom thought they had 6 children when they had 5. Teachers in the 4 year old classroom did not complete the Center's procedure of name of the child and sight roll call prior to transitioning to the outdoor play space. When asked two separate times, once while in the center and once as the group got outside into the outdoor play space, staff indicated they had 7 children when they had 8. | ||
2021-06-22 | 251.06(2)(i) | Deteriorating Paint |
Description: There is deteriorating paint on a blue bench seat, red bench seat, and wooden kitchen set in the 2 year old classroom, the white deck leading to the outdoor play space, and on a picnic table and some pallets located in the outdoor play space. | ||
2021-06-22 | 251.07(6)(f)1.a. | Medication Administration - Parent Authorization |
Description: A child in the 2 year old classroom had a parent authorization for cold medicine to be administered as needed on June 18, 2021. | ||
2021-06-22 | 251.055(1)(b) | Supervision - Teacher Per Group Of Children |
Description: Children in the 2 year old classroom did not have a qualified teacher supervising their group. The staff member who has been assigned to this classroom as the teacher for approximately one month does not meet the qualifications of a teacher per licensing requirements. | ||
2020-08-31 | Licensing | No violations found *** |
2020-02-06 | 251.04(6)(a)8.a. | Child Record - Physical Exam - Under 2 |
Description: The health exam documentation on file for one child under the age of 2 years (child #4) was not current. The most recent exam was dated 07/29/2019. | ||
2019-08-26 | 251.07(2)(c) | Time-Out - Time Limit |
Description: Based on a complaint investigation ending 08/26/2019, the Director stated that child #1 was made to stay in the office for 30 to 45 minutes on at least one occasion in response to disruptive behaviors until the Director determined the child had calmed down enough to be allowed back into the classroom. | ||
2019-08-26 | 251.07(2)(d) | Time-Out - Use With Children Under Age 3 |
Description: Based on staff interview, time outs were given to 2-year-olds in the calm down area of their classroom. | ||
2019-08-09 | Licensing | No violations found *** |
2019-07-01 | 251.04(8)(b) | Biennial Training - Child Abuse & Neglect |
Description: Based on record review and interview, there was no documentation of current training in Child Abuse and Neglect for Staff F. | ||
2019-07-01 | 251.04(2)(a) | Compliance With Laws |
Description: Contrary to s. 48.686(4m)(c) Wis. Stats., the center failed to obtain an approved preliminary report indicating that Staff F was eligible to work in the child care program prior to becoming a caregiver. | ||
2019-07-01 | 251.07(6)(f)1.a. | Medication Administration - Parent Authorization |
Description: The center did not obtain written authorization from the physician, or a pharmacy label, for an "as needed" prescription medication for child #1. The parent signed the authorization on file. The physician's authorization for child #2's medication did not include any dates. |
